The Role of Macronutrients
The energy value of food is largely determined by its macronutrient composition, consisting of three primary components:
- Carbohydrates: Each gram of carbohydrate provides approximately 4 calories.
- Proteins: Like carbohydrates, proteins also yield about 4 calories per gram.
- Fats: Fats are more energy-dense, providing about 9 calories per gram.
Understanding the caloric contribution of these macronutrients is fundamental when calculating the energy value of food.

3. Manual Calculation
If you prefer a hands-on approach, here’s a simple method for calculating the energy value of food based on its macronutrient content.
Step-by-Step Calculation
- Obtain Macronutrient Information: You can find this information from nutritional labels or food composition databases.
- Use the Caloric Values: Multiply the grams of each macronutrient by its caloric value:
- Calories from Carbohydrates = Grams of Carbohydrates x 4
- Calories from Proteins = Grams of Proteins x 4
- Calories from Fats = Grams of Fats x 9
- Add It All Together: Sum the results to obtain the total caloric content.
For example, if a food item contains 15g of carbohydrates, 10g of protein, and 5g of fat:
– Calories from Carbohydrates = 15g x 4 = 60 calories
– Calories from Proteins = 10g x 4 = 40 calories
– Calories from Fats = 5g x 9 = 45 calories
Total Calories = 60 + 40 + 45 = 145 calories

Are all calories created equal?
No, not all calories are created equal. The body processes different macronutrients in distinct ways, leading to varying effects on energy levels, satiety, and overall health. For example, 100 calories from a candy bar may provide a quick energy spike, while 100 calories from nuts or whole grains deliver sustained energy due to their fiber and protein content.
Additionally, what you eat can influence other factors such as blood sugar levels, hormone regulation, and nutrient absorption. Opting for nutrient-dense foods, which provide vitamins and minerals along with their calories, can significantly contribute to better health compared to consuming empty calories from processed foods.

Can the energy value of food be affected by cooking methods?
Yes, cooking methods can impact the energy value of food. Certain cooking techniques can alter the nutritional composition and caloric density of food. For example, boiling vegetables can lead to the loss of some water-soluble vitamins, while frying food in oil can increase its fat content and, thereby, its calorie count significantly.
Additionally, cooking methods can affect the digestibility of foods. Cooking certain foods, like legumes, can break down anti-nutrients and make it easier for the body to access their energy content. Therefore, understanding how cooking methods influence the energy value of food is essential for accurate calorie calculations and making healthier cooking choices.
